'We deserved to win'
FT: Real Sociedad 2-1 Barcelona
Barcelona
Barcelona's Frenkie de Jong speaking after the game: "I thought we deserved to win. We had the chances to do that, but you have to score the goals. I think we played well, but we haven't won the game. We had so many opportunities. Their goalkeeper had a very good game."
On the offside goals: "If it's offside it's offside. I haven't seen it. I spoke to the fourth official and said it wasn't offside, but if offside is given then it's offside.
"The only thing I can say is you can't ralk to this referee. I tried to speak to him but he looked at me with a face to say 'why are you talking to me'. Very frustrating."
On if they lost because of the referee: "No. We missed so many chances. That's the most disappointing thing."
